20 Flyovers for over Rs.2k crore
The Telangana Government has given administrative approval for the construction of 20 multi-level flyovers and junctions at an estimated cost of Rs 2,631 crore
Hyderabad roads to be repaired at Rs 250 cr
A comprehensive road development project has been taken up to improve the overall condition of Hyderabad city roads, the Greater Hyderabad Municipal Corporation (GHMC) has stated. The first phase of the project is to be initiated at an estimated cost of Rs 250 crore.
Road repairs in Hyd to be given to contractors
Maintenance of about 500 km length of roads in Hyderabad would soon be outsourced by the Greater Hyderabad Municipal Corporation (GHMC). In the first phase, main roads will be given for annual maintenance contract and would be extended to other roads in the later phases if it yields good results.
Civic body to take over R&B roads in Hyderabad
The Andhra Pradesh government will soon issue a government order (GO) for handing over Roads & Buildings (R&B) Department's roads to the Greater Hyderabad Municipal Corporation (GHMC) by creating a separate division, said GHMC Commissioner Somesh Kumar on November 5.

GHMC faces criticism for not widening city roads
The Greater Hyderabad Municipal Corporation (GHMC) has been severely criticised by the MIM floor leader in State Assembly, Akbaruddin Owaisi on October 21 for not taking up road widening works in the city on priority basis. He pointed out that land rates in the city have increased four times since its proposal of road widening.

Hyderabad civic body sets Oct 10 as deadline to repair roads
To repair potholed damaged roads in Hyderabad-Secunderabad twin cities, the Greater Hyderabad Municipal Corporation (GHMC) has set a deadline of October 10 for its engineers and contractors concerned. GHMC has estimated the repairs to cost Rs 15 crore. Forts it will take all the main corridors and main city roads immediately for the repair works. Later, inner lanes and by-lanes will be taken up.
GHMC proposes Rs 870 cr road works, civic projects
In Hyderabad, Rs 870 crore civic projects have been proposed by the Greater Hyderabad Municipal Corporation (GHMC). GHMC had bagged the projects under the phase-I (2005-2012) of the Jawaharlal Nehru National Urban Renewal Mission (JNNURM). The State-level committee on JNNURM works cleared the proposals for these projects recently and the project proposals would be sending to the Union Ministry for Urban Development soon.
